Client Acquisition
Client acquisition is essential for any franchise's survival, and employing a client-focused strategy ensures enduring bonds with customers. Several approaches can optimize this process:
Leverage Customer Feedback: Adjusting products or services based on customer input is crucial to directly address client needs. Trader Joe’s serves as a prime example of how careful observation and adaptation can result in higher sales and stronger community ties.
Referral Programs: Expand your network by leveraging loyal customers as potent promotional tools. Companies like Robinhood thrive on this concept, rewarding existing clients for referring new customers, which not only draws in new clients but also significantly cuts down on traditional acquisition costs.
Engage on Social Media: Platforms like LinkedIn offer franchises an opportunity to build strong client relationships and boost brand visibility. Crafting engaging, client-focused content can establish emotional connections that lead to customer loyalty.
Client-Centric Policies
Franchises that emphasize customer priorities in their policies create a unique competitive advantage, ensuring retention and satisfaction.
Exceptional Customer Service: Emulating Zappos, franchises can embed exceptional service principles into their core operations, cultivating deep customer loyalty and a willingness to invest more in their offerings.
Generous Return Policies: Relaxed return policies, like those at Costco, foster a strong sense of consumer trust, boosting customer confidence and encouraging repeat visits.
Personalized Experiences: Companies such as Stitch Fix illustrate how tailored services that meet specific customer expectations lead the charge in client retention, providing an exemplary model of a genuine client-focused approach.
Fostering Community Connections
A major factor in a franchise's success is establishing and maintaining community connections, which secure brand loyalty and foster positive community sentiment.
Hosting Events: Activities rooted in the community, like workshops and local events hosted by franchises such as Color Me Mine, integrate businesses into local life, playing a critical role in neighborhood engagement and strengthening brand reputation.
Partnerships with Local Organizations: Building partnerships with local groups such as schools and charities enhances community visibility and goodwill, allowing for mutual growth opportunities.
Engaging in Local Charitable Activities: Businesses involved in fundraising and community volunteering bolster their brand image, enhancing goodwill and cultivating deeper customer relationships.
